'Arabeca' (Maynard Knopf, R. 1966). Seedling 64-14. TB, 36" (91 cm), Midseason to late bloom. Color Class-Y4Ocm, Standards old gold; Falls garnet brown with purple infusion. 'Melodrama' X 'Campbell Copper'. Knopf 1967.

| From Knopf Iris Gardens catalog, 1967: ARABECA: Sdlg. No 64-14 TB 36" M-L Season. Melodrama x Campbell Copper. Standards are old gold. Falls are brown with purple infusion, flare horizontally. Standards are domed and show off the immense serrated style arms. Beard is brown. Excellent substance, branching and texture. Fertile both ways. An eye-catcher. Net $25.00 |
